Dyer Brown has been selected to be the project architect for 180 Guest Street (the Mass Electric Company building) in Brighton, MA which recently was purchased by New Balance. The Brighton-based athletic company just publicly announced their purchase of both the Mass Electric Company building as well as the vacant lot next to their headquarters building. Dyer Brown is currently providing ongoing field verification of the building as well as vacant suite prep for approximately 9,000 SF.
